Super Chelsea star's misdemeanor throws Paris Olympics into disarray. This is the story of Argentina national team player Enzo Fernandez. He won the trophy at the Copa America, which ended in the middle of last month. Upon arriving in Argentina, Fernandez posted a live video on social media of him singing a cheering song on a bus

However, the cheer song was a cheer song that insulted the French. Argentina won the penalty shootout against France. 2022 For the 2008 FIFA World Cup in Qatar, they created this song, which contains "racist lyrics" about the French team. It is now Argentina's most popular cheer song. If you look at the lyrics of the cheer song, "all the French players are from Angola". "French players have Nigerian mothers and Cameroonian fathers." Especially the sexual mockery of French national team ace Kylian Mbappe. It's a cheer song full of obviously racist lyrics.

After realizing the seriousness of the situation, Fernandez immediately apologized, and after attending Chelsea's preseason game in the United States, he formally apologized to his teammates, so the situation appeared to have calmed down. However, the Olympics, currently being held in Paris, France, ended up in an accident. Coincidentally, France and Argentina met in the men's soccer quarterfinals. Thierry Henry, the head coach of France's Under-23 Olympics, defeated Argentina 1-0 in the early hours of the morning of the 3rd to advance to the semifinals at the Stade de Bordeaux in Bordeaux, France. An incident occurred after the match. A heated fight broke out between players from the French and Argentine teams. European media reported on the 3rd that after the match, players from both teams had a heated clash. It is reported that the French midfielder Enzo Milo was too enthusiastic about winning against the Argentine players after the match, which led to the outbreak of the Argentine players. On the field, players from both teams started fighting and pushing each other. Some players tried to stop this, but to no avail. The chaos continued to extend into the tunnel. Even before this day's match, the two teams showed animosity over Enzo Fernandez's live cheering broadcast, which eventually erupted after the match was decided. Before the match against Argentina, France's Olympic head coach Henri was asked about the incident. He said, "Provocation from Argentina? I'm not going to talk about it," he said contemptuously, "As a coach, I have a game to prepare for. Just want to talk about the game. It's important," he said.
